What Do You Mean By Sagwan Wood?

Sagwan wood is popular for use in furniture and flooring because of its durability and resistance to rot and insect damage. The wood is also used for making boats and other outdoor equipment.

Sagwan wood has a high oil content, which makes it resistant to water damage and makes it an ideal material for use in humid climates. Sagwan wood is usually a light brown color with a close grain.what is sagwan wood

Sagwan wood is an extremely popular choice for furniture and flooring because of its many benefits. Sagwan wood is also resistant to rot and insect damage, making it a good choice for use in humid climates.

As the wood has a high oil content in it, which makes it resistant to water damage, difficult for termites to eat the wood, and also makes it an ideal material to use in multiple climates. Sagwan wood is usually a light brown color wood in nature with a close grain.

How to Take Care of Sagwan Wood?

Sagwan wood is a durable and beautiful material that can be used for a variety of purposes, from furniture to flooring. However, like all wood products, it needs to be properly cared for in order to maintain its beauty and longevity.

  1. Dust Regularly – Dust your sagwan furniture or floors with a soft cloth or brush attachment on your vacuum cleaner.
  2. Polish Regularly – Once every few months, use a good quality polish designed specifically for wood products. This will help protect the sagwan from scratches and other wear and tear.
  3. Avoid Excessive Moisture – Don’t let water or other liquids sit on sagwan wood for too long, as this can damage the finish. Wipe up any spills immediately.
  4. Keep it Clean – In general, just keep your sagwan wood products clean and free of debris to help them last longer.
